.progressbar{display:flex;flex-wrap:nowrap;align-content:center;justify-content:center;align-items:center;color:#fff}.progressbar-icon svg{text-align:center;width:30px;height:30px;line-height:25px;display:block;font-size:20px;color:#fff;background:#9da3a7;border-radius:50%;margin:10px;padding:5px}.active svg{background:#ee1a16!important}.progressbar-icon{position:relative;z-index:1}.progressbar-icon:before{content:"";border-top:2px solid #dfdfdf;margin:0 auto;position:absolute;top:50%;left:0;right:0;bottom:0;width:100%;z-index:-1}.search-bar{width:100%;height:50px;max-width:500px;display:flex;align-items:center;padding:5px;margin-right:auto;margin-left:auto;border:1px solid #b5b1b1;border-radius:40px;box-shadow:0 6px 8px #00000026;background:#fff}.search-bar:focus{box-shadow:0 3px 4px #00000026}.search-bar input{background:none;flex:1;padding:10px;font-size:16px;color:#343a40;border-radius:50px;width:195px;border:1px solid #fff;-webkit-appearance:none;-moz-appearance:none;appearance:none;outline:none}::placeholder{color:gray}.search-bar button{height:20px;width:20px;padding:0;margin:10px 10px 17px;border:none;background:none;outline:none!important;cursor:pointer;color:#626e7a}.counter-container{display:flex;justify-content:start;margin:.8rem 0}.circle-controller{width:1rem;height:1rem;background-color:#fff;color:#343a40;display:flex;justify-content:center;align-items:center;font-size:14px;border-radius:50%;cursor:pointer;margin:0 10px;border:1px solid #343a40}.counter-input{width:40px;height:20px;text-align:center;font-size:12px;border-radius:5px;border:1px solid #bbb}
